Description:
Establish and maintain GitLab repositories for version control, code collaboration, and tracking changes to scripts, documentation, and system configurations. Implement role-based access controls (RBAC) in GitLab, ensuring only authorized personnel can access and modify repositories. Submit the GitLab Access & Security Compliance Report, documenting repository management, user access controls, and security policies.
Job Requirements:
Experience:
Possess the knowledge and capability to administer, maintain, and optimize GitLab for version control, repository management, and secure DevSecOps workflows. Personnel must be proficient in CI/CD pipeline configuration, access control management, and code repository best practices. Strong troubleshooting and automation skills are required to support software development teams. Personnel must have demonstrated experience in managing Git repositories, implementing CI/CD pipelines, and ensuring secure DevSecOps integration. Experience with access control policies, automated testing frameworks, and software configuration management is required.
Education:
A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Software Engineering, or a related field, or five (5) years of equivalent experience in GitLab administration. Desirable but not required certifications include GitLab Certified Associate or Certified Kubernetes Administrator (CKA).
